--- liblscp/trunk/ChangeLog 2006/12/18 09:39:20 983 +++ liblscp/trunk/ChangeLog 2008/02/14 17:05:51 1689 @@ -3,7 +3,66 @@ ChangeLog -0.5.1 2006-12-18 Updated examples. +CVS HEAD Added support for new (un)subscribable events: + LSCP_EVENT_CHANNEL_MIDI + Caution: the bitflag approach for the event variable + is now abondoned, since otherwise we would soon hit the + limit of the bit range. The bitflag approach will + remain for events older at this point (that is all + events which occupy the lower 16 bits), but this new + and all following events will simply be enumared along + the upper 16 bits. + + Added new client interface function, for renaming + effect send entities: + lscp_set_fxsend_name(); + +0.5.5 2007-10-12 Changed client interface function, for editing + instrument, from: + lscp_edit_instrument(); + to: + lscp_edit_channel_instrument(); + +0.5.4 2007-10-02 Added new client interface function, for editing + instrument: + lscp_edit_instrument(); + + Fixed some minor bugs in: + lscp_set_fxsend_midi_controller(); + lscp_set_fxsend_level(); + +0.5.3 2007-01-15 Added new client interface functions, for sampler + channel effect sends control: + lscp_set_fxsend_midi_controller(); + lscp_set_fxsend_level(); + + Added new field member to lscp_fxsend_info_t (level). + +0.5.2 2007-01-11 Added new client interface functions, for sampler + channel effect sends control: + lscp_create_fxsend(); + lscp_destroy_fxsend(); + lscp_get_fxsends(); + lscp_list_fxsends(); + lscp_get_fxsend_info(); + lscp_set_fxsend_audio_channel(); + and for global volume: + lscp_get_volume(); + lscp_set_volume(); + + Audio routing representation changed to integer array. + +0.5.1 2006-12-22 Added support for new (un)subscribable events: + LSCP_EVENT_AUDIO_OUTPUT_DEVICE_COUNT, + LSCP_EVENT_AUDIO_OUTPUT_DEVICE_INFO, + LSCP_EVENT_MIDI_INPUT_DEVICE_COUNT, + LSCP_EVENT_MIDI_INPUT_DEVICE_INFO, + LSCP_EVENT_MIDI_INSTRUMENT_MAP_COUNT, + LSCP_EVENT_MIDI_INSTRUMENT_MAP_INFO, + LSCP_EVENT_MIDI_INSTRUMENT_COUNT, + LSCP_EVENT_MIDI_INSTRUMENT_INFO. + + Updated examples. 0.5.0 2006-12-17 MIDI instrument mapping, second round, according to LSCP 1.2 draft document as of December 15, 2006.